About Gurinder Gill

Globally recognized Punjabi-Canadian singer, songwriter, and record producer Gurinder Gill has been one of the fastest rising artists in the world. He has explored various musical styles and has proven himself to be exceptionally versatile while continuing to embrace his cultural undertones. His first single “Faraar” in 2020 with Shinda Kahlon showcased his ability to merge his Punjabi Folkstyle vocals with rhythmic musical patterns reminiscent of western hip-hop resulting in a unique crossover. Ever since, he has effectively taken the Punjabi music industry by storm. Working alongside his label-mates AP Dhillon and Shinda Kahlon, Gurinder has solidified himself as one of the world’s most exciting talents. Various songs featuring the trio have peaked on UK Asian and Punjabi music charts. His 2020 release "Majhail" with AP Dhillon peaked at number 1 on UK's Official Punjabi Music Chart Top 20. "Excuses" and "Brown Munde" followed suit shortly after, peaking on both UK Asian and Punjabi charts with "Brown Munde" peaking at #1 on Spotify in India. His meteoric rise to the top of the charts in such a short period of time proves to be unprecedented in its nature and his latest release, an album titled "Not By Chance" with MoneyMusik and AP Dhillon, also redefines the sound and global appeal of Punjabi music. He is also known for records such as “Droptop”, “Free Smoke”, “Don’t Test” and “Most Wanted” and many more.
